Transaction 951070d4f86cd5dbdc5697139bb4fcdcc22f543d216f2f8c0cb43dfc8ebd2136
1 Input
2 Outputs
- 951070d4f86cd5dbdc5697139bb4fcdcc22f543d216f2f8c0cb43dfc8ebd2136:0
- 951070d4f86cd5dbdc5697139bb4fcdcc22f543d216f2f8c0cb43dfc8ebd2136:1
value 16826
address 1HUrMCDGdgiR14W6yvRCEwuDnj3JrHfA8n
value 900539
address 3CPtk8dCgmyWXWhNgR8kJCFBH139keV194